Tokyo Lifestyle Co., Ltd.

Tokyo Lifestyle Co., Ltd. engages in the retail and wholesale of beauty, health, sundry, and other products in Japan, China, Hong Kong, the United States, Canada, Thailand, and the United Kingdom. The company sells its products under its flagship brand, Tokyo Lifestyle. It offers cosmetics comprising foundation, powder, concealer, makeup remover, eyeliner, eye shadow, brow powder, brow pencil, mascara, lip gloss, lipstick, and nail polish; skin care, consisting of facial cleanser, whitening products, sun block, moisturizer, facial mask, eye mask, eye gel, and exfoliating; and cosmetic applicators, including brush, puff, curler, hair iron, and shaver products. The company also provides shampoo, conditioner, and body wash; fragrance products consisting of perfume and cologne for women and men. In addition, the company provides facial wash, firming lotion, astringent, and moisturizer products for men; and lip balm, lotion, shampoo, soap, and essence oil for baby and children. Further, the company offers OTC drugs for the treatment of colds, headaches, stomach pain, cough, and eye strains, and others, as well as medical supplies and devices, including bandages, masks, thermometers, disinfectant sprays, eye masks, contact lens, and contact lens cleaners and solutions. Additionally, the company provides vitamins, minerals, fiber supplements, nutritional yeast, dietary products, and other nutritional supplements; bedding and bath, home décor, dining and tabletop, storage containers, car supplies, cleaning agent, and laundry supplies; spa supplies, clothing, formula milk, and diapers; and food, alcoholic beverages, and miscellaneous products. It also offers branded watches, perfumes, handbags, clothes, and jewelries, as well as Nintendo switch and Xbox series products. The company was formerly known as Yoshitsu Co., Ltd and changed its name to Tokyo Lifestyle Co., Ltd. in October 2024. Tokyo Lifestyle Co., Ltd. was incorporated in 2006 and is headquartered in Tokyo, Japan.
